Reprogramming and Differentiation of Cutaneous Squamous Cell Carcinoma Cells in Recessive Dystrophic Epidermolysis Bullosa.
International journal of molecular sciences - 29 Dec 2020
Rami Avina, Łaczmański Łukasz, Jacków-Nowicka Jagoda, Jacków Joanna
Abstract excerpt
The early onset and rapid progression of cutaneous squamous cell carcinoma (cSCC) leads to high mortality rates in individuals with recessive dystrophic epidermolysis bullosa (RDEB). Currently, the molecular mechanisms underlying cSCC development in RDEB are not well understood and there are limited therapeutic options.
